Strict TGA Conformity & Clinical Compliance

Exporting orthopedic implants to Australia demands rigorous compliance with the Therapeutic Goods Administration (TGA) frameworks. As an export-oriented manufacturer, our systems align with international standards such as ISO 13485:2016 and MDSAP (Medical Device Single Audit Program). We provide comprehensive technical documentation, raw material certificates (ASTM F136 titanium and ASTM F2026 medical-grade PEEK), and biological safety evaluation reports in compliance with ISO 10993 to streamline the local sponsor registration process.

Materials Science & Technology Roadmap

Maka Medical leverages advanced material engineering to produce implants that match human biomechanics, preventing stress shielding and ensuring high longevity. Our technical roadmap focuses on three core material groups:

  • โš™๏ธ Medical-Grade Titanium Alloys (Ti-6Al-4V ELI): Yielding exceptional fatigue strength and corrosion resistance. Our CNC processing lines handle precision turning of titanium pedicle screws and intramedullary nails, achieving tolerances of ±0.005mm.
  • โ– Advanced PEEK (Polyetheretherketone): Mimicking the elastic modulus of cortical bone. PEEK cages provide excellent radiolucency, allowing surgeons to monitor fusion progress accurately via X-ray and CT scans without scatter artifacts.
  • ๐Ÿงช Surface Modifications & Bioactive Coating: Development pathways for titanium plasma spray (TPS) and hydroxyapatite (HA) coating options to accelerate early stage bone-to-implant contact (BIC).

By implementing strict QA/QC testing, including mechanical fatigue tests in simulated body fluid (SBF) environments, we ensure our implants maintain integrity under cyclic loading conditions characteristic of active Australian patients.

Frequently Asked Questions

Answering key regulatory, shipping, and technical manufacturing questions for Australian medical buyers.

Q: How does Maka Medical support the TGA registration process for Australian importers?
We supply full documentation dossiers, including ISO 13485:2016 certificates, raw material trace sheets (for titanium alloys and PEEK), biocompatibility evaluation test reports (ISO 10993 series), and manufacturing quality protocols. This speeds up your application with the Therapeutic Goods Administration (TGA) for therapeutic goods inclusion.
Q: What raw material standards do you use for your implants?
We use medical-grade Titanium Alloy (Ti-6Al-4V ELI) complying with ASTM F136 and pure PEEK polymers complying with ASTM F2026. Every material batch comes with mill certificate verification to ensure structural integrity and patient safety.
Q: Can you manufacture custom sizing for trauma plates and screws?
Yes, our multi-axis CNC machines allow for full OEM/ODM customization. We can adjust lengths, thread pitches, surface finishes, and anatomical curves according to your provided engineering drawings or 3D models.
Q: What is the typical lead time for shipping to Australian ports?
Standard stock items are shipped within 7-14 business days. For bulk OEM orders, production typically takes 30-45 days, followed by fast air freight (3-7 days to Sydney/Melbourne/Brisbane) or sea freight (18-25 days).
Q: Do you offer sterile packaging for your implants?
We provide both non-sterile bulk packaging and sterile single-implant packaging options. Our cleanroom facilities meet international standards, allowing for reliable aseptic processing and clean packaging to minimize contaminants.
